Mr. Ahmad Dawood[edit]

The spirit behind the Group's phenomenal success, was born at Bantva in the Kathiwar region of pre-independence India. Mr. Dawood, at the age of only 18 started his business career in Bombay as a dealer of cotton and rayon yarnand soon entered in industry by establishing a cotton ginning and pressing factory, an oil mill and a vegetable oil factory. Under his supervision and wise guidance his business activities expanded rapidly with new branches opening in several parts of India such as Calcutta, Madras, Kanpur, Coimbatur, Mathura, Ludhiana, Amritsar and Dehli.

Migration of Pakistan[edit]

Ahmed Dawood was a pillar of private sector, he was asked by [Quaied-e-Azam Muhammad Ali Jinnah]http://www.dawn.com/2002/01/03/top8.htm to migrate to Pakistan and set up Industries there.

Ahmed Dawood had lost all his business assets worth millions of rupees, spread all over India at the time of creation of Pakistan in 1947. Mr. Dawood brought with him to Pakistan in 1947, the great wealth of experience and a keen spirit of the enterprise that was desperately needed for industrial stability of the newly created country. In their new homeland, the Dawoods soon secured country-wide reputation for zestful initiative and foresight in planning and implementing new industrial projects in the country under the flag of The Dawood Group. The Group has set up a diverse complex of industries in Pakistan keeping in close harmony with the requirements of national progress and business prosperity skillfully using Indigenous capital as well as foreign investment to satisfying gains of the participants and to the development of Pakistan as a modern industrializing Country.

Looking Back to Seventies[edit]

Dawood had to face another serious setback at the time of Dhaka fall in 1971. At that time he again lost huge industrial and business projects like [Karnafuly Paper Mills Limited]http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/KarnaFuli_Paper_Mill

Kernafuly Rayon and Chemicals Limited Dawood Jute Mills

Dawood Shipping Company with a fleet of 25 cargo ships.

All these assets slipped out of his hand with the separation of the East Pakistan and taken by the new Government.

In 1974, Dawood Group had to suffer huge losses due to nationalization policy enforced by Government of that time. Major industrial and philanthropic projects of Dawood Group including

[Dawood Petroleum]http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Pakistan_State_Oil

Central Life Insurance Company Limited

[Dawood Engineering College]http://www.dcet.edu.pk/about-dcet.html

were nationalized by the Government.

A Tradition of Service to the Nation[edit]

The welfare of the fellow country men is always at the heart of Dawood Family. The Dawoods formed the [Dawood Foundation]http://www.memon-world.net/welfare_inst4.htm, one of the largest public charitable trusts in the country, in 1961, with assets exceeding Rs. 50 Million. The Foundation has contributed large sums of money for establishment and funding of a number schools, colleges, dispensaries and hospitals in the country. The Foundation contributed Rs. 10.5 million to [Al-Shifa Trust] for establishment of modern hospital complex at Rawalpindi. This was the largest single donation from the private Sector.

in 1962, the Foundation established the well known [Dawood College of Engineering and Technology]http://www.dcet.edu.pk/about-dcet.html. The college which was the first institution in the coountry with degree courses in Chemical Engineering, Electronics, Metallurgy, and Architecture was nationalized in 1971 and now run by the Fedral Government.

Foundation has also constructed an education complex in Karachi known as Dawood Public School for Girls.

Dawoods played a leading role in the public welfare. Dawood Foundation was set up in 1961 with a capital of Rs25 million. Dawood Engineering College was set up in sixties which was later nationalized. It is still a leading institution of technical education.
